What is the difference between a notification letter and a citation?

0

A notification letter is sent to property owners and tenants notifying them of the violation giving a set time frame to take care of the violation. If the violation is not taken care upon the second inspection then all documentation is turned over to the city attorneys office to issue a citation. A citation is the document that makes the violation official requiring a fine to be paid.
